The present invention relates to a variable timing constant decision-directed timing recovery method, the method comprising: outputting an output value and a determination error value of an equalizer in an equalizer, having an absolute value in the determination error value, Comparing the absolute value of the determination error and the value of the threshold detector, selecting the compared output value among the adaptive coefficient values, adding the alpha and beta to the timing constants, and outputting the D / A Controlling the voltage-controlled oscillator through the converter, and optionally varying the timing constant according to the amount of error in the equalizer to accumulate the timing phase and, in the case of large crystal error, If the timing phase recovery speed is small and the error is small, it is possible to track the exact phase by applying the negative adaptation coefficient.
